Star Group L.P. re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$2.66, with no consensus estimate available for comparison. Revenue figures were not disclosed in the earnings release. The stock declined by $1.25 following the announcement. The EPS result reflects typical seasonal strength in the company’s propane and home heating oil distribution business during the winter quarter.

The Q1 2026 earnings performance was underpinned by robust demand for residential heating fuels, as colder-than-normal temperatures in key service areas boosted customer consumption. Star Group’s propane segment likely benefited from higher volumes, while per-unit margins may have been supported by stable wholesale propane prices and disciplined retail pricing. The company’s operational efficiency continued to benefit from its network of local branches, which provide flexible delivery and customer service. Segment dynamics were influenced by the mix of heating oil and propane sales, with propane contributing a growing share of total volumes due to ongoing conversions from other fuels. Operating expenses appeared well-controlled, though weather variability remains a critical factor. The reported EPS of $2.66 compares favorably with the company’s typical Q1 performance, as the quarter captures peak heating activity. No revenue or margin details were provided in the available data, limiting granular analysis of top-line trends. Investors may look for more comprehensive disclosures in the company’s formal 10-Q filing. Star Group L.P. Looking ahead, Star Group’s management has not released explicit guidance for the remainder of fiscal 2026. However, based on historical patterns, the company may experience a sharp decline in earnings during the spring and summer quarters when heating demand subsides. The outlook remains heavily dependent on weather conditions, particularly in the Northeast and Midwest, where the company concentrates its operations. Commodity price fluctuations could also affect margins; a rapid increase in wholesale propane or heating oil costs might compress retail spreads if competition limits price pass-through. Conversely, mild winter weather in subsequent quarters could pressure volumes and EPS. Star Group continues to pursue strategic priorities such as bolt-on acquisitions and organic customer growth, which may support long-term profitability but carry integration risks. Additionally, the company’s partnership structure requires careful management of cash distributions to unitholders, a factor that could influence investor sentiment if earnings disappoint. The stock’s decline of $1.25 on the day of the earnings release suggests that investors may have focused on the lack of revenue detail or broader market headwinds. Without a revenue figure or comparable estimate, the market reaction may reflect disappointment that the company did not provide more comprehensive financial disclosures. Analysts covering the stock have not yet issued updated commentary, but the solid EPS print could support a stable valuation for a name that typically trades on yield and seasonal earnings power. Key items to watch include the full 10-Q filing for revenue and gross margin data, as well as any commentary on customer retention and winter weather normalization. The company’s ability to sustain distribution coverage amid variable earnings will remain a focal point. Given the lack of guidance, near-term price movement may be driven by macroeconomic factors such as energy prices and interest rates. The fundamental outlook for the business remains tied to heating degree days and cost management.
